TUITION FEES | University of Leicester Tuition
fees for 2012 entry: £9,000 What
they say: "Leicester
is unique. Of the UK’s top-15 leading universities, as ranked by the Times Good
University Guide, only one meets its government benchmarks for inclusivity for
students from state schools and lower socio-economic groups. That university is
Leicester. As the Times Higher described us, we are elite without being elitist.
In making our decision about fees we need to stay true to this characteristic. The
Government has announced cuts in University funding over the next four years that
will reduce our teaching grant by an estimated £31.5m. Our capital funding will
also fall. A higher tuition fee of £9,000 is therefore essential to protect the
quality of our work. But
we are determined that no able student should be deterred from studying by the
prospect of higher fees. We will therefore offer one of the largest and most comprehensive
programmes of scholarships in the sector." Source:
http://www2.le.ac.uk/staff/announcements/archive/may-2011/tuition-fees-announcment-message-from-professor-sir-robert-burgess-vice-chancellor

Information correct as
of February 2012. Please note this page focuses on the new tuition fees system
payable by UK (Home) and EU students on a full-time undergraduate degree course
in England. The system for international students has not changed radically and,
therefore, annual fees for international students are likely to remain unchanged
and higher than those stated on this page.
